2. Top 10 Evaluation Criteria for Selecting a Trade Show Exhibit & Factory Partner
Selecting a premier trade show exhibit and custom racking manufacturer requires a rigorous audit across technical engineering, metal fabrication precision, surface finishing, and compliance standards. Below are the key evaluation criteria defined by industry experts:
1. Steel Grade & Structural Yield Strength
Premium factories utilize high-tensile cold-rolled steel (Q235B to Q355 grade), offering structural stability under immense dynamic stresses during high-footfall expos.
2. Precision Automated Cold-Roll Forming
Computerized continuous roll-forming ensures microscopic tolerance controls on upright posts, crossbeams, and interlocking booth structural connectors.
3. Modular Boltless Assembly Systems
Time-critical trade show setups require toolless assembly mechanisms, teardown speed optimization, and dynamic height-adjustable shelf/display beam tiers.
4. Electrostatic Powder Coating & Durability
Multi-stage automated washing, phosphating, and thermo-cured electrostatic powder coating protect exhibit components against scratches, impacts, and corrosion.
5. Ultrasonic & NDT Weld Inspection
Rigid Quality Assurance utilizing automated ultrasonic testing and load-bearing fatigue analysis prevents structural joint failures during live events.
6. OEM/ODM Spatial Customization
In-house engineering teams capable of modifying structural dimensions, color palettes, LED channel integrations, and heavy product display interfaces.

4. Technical Specification Matrix & Structural Engineering Comparison
To assist global procurement directors, trade show booth builders, and logistics planners in selecting the appropriate exhibit frame architecture, the table below provides engineering benchmark comparisons:
| Exhibit & Racking Classification | Primary Structural Material | Load Capacity (Per Tier / Deck) | Surface Finishing Process | Primary Application Scenario |
|---|---|---|---|---|
| Heavy-Duty Selective Pallet Racking | Cold-Rolled Steel Q235B / Q355 | 1,000 kg – 4,500 kg | Thermosetting Powder Coat (80μm) | Heavy Industrial Trade Shows, 3PL Warehousing, Machinery Demos |
| Medium-Duty Modular Display Racks | High-Tensile Rolled Steel | 200 kg – 800 kg | Anti-Scratch Electrostatic Coating | Commercial Trade Booths, Hardware Expos, Multi-Tier Displays |
| Boltless Quick-Assembly Steel Shelving | Precision Molded Steel Frame | 150 kg – 350 kg | Corrosion Protection Powder Finish | Rapid-Deployment Booths, Retail Expos, Mobile Display Units |
| Custom Heavy-Duty Cantilever Racks | Structural H-Steel / Cold Rolled | 500 kg – 3,000 kg / Arm | Hot-Dip Galvanized / Outdoor Coating | Pipe, Lumber, & Architectural Material Trade Exhibitions |
| Drive-In & Stacking Rack Systems | Reinforced Structural Steel | 800 kg – 2,000 kg | High-Impact Industrial Coating | High-Density Modular Exhibition Pods & Bulk Storage Sets |
5. Localized Regional Application Scenarios & Macro Solutions
Industrial display specifications vary significantly based on geographic venue standards, regional safety codes, and buyer intent. Top manufacturers engineer tailored setups for specific global territories:
- North American Market (USA & Canada): High demand for heavy-duty double-deck exhibition frameworks, boltless assembly systems adhering to OSHA and ANSI MH16.1 specifications. Exhibitors prioritize rapid drayage setup times and extreme structural stability for machinery showcases.
- Western European Market (Germany, France, UK): Strict focus on Eurocode 3 (EN 1993) steel design standards, environmental sustainability, VOC-free powder coatings, and reusable modular booth frames suitable for international convention centers like Messe Frankfurt or Fiera Milano.
- Middle Eastern & Southeast Asian Markets (UAE, KSA, Singapore): High requirement for thermal-resistant, anti-corrosive powder finishes (such as cold-room certified racking) capable of handling harsh, humid ambient conditions during mega industrial expos and logistics summits.
